What is Game Design?

Game design is the process of creating the concepts, mechanics, characters, environments, and user experiences that make a game engaging and enjoyable. A game designer combines creativity, storytelling, art, and technology to build interactive experiences for players.

Game design is not just about playing games; it involves planning gameplay, designing levels, creating characters, balancing challenges, and ensuring a smooth user experience.

What is Level Design?

Level design is the process of creating the stages, maps, and gameplay flow within a game.

A level designer focuses on:

  • Player navigation
  • Challenges and puzzles
  • Enemy placement
  • Reward systems
  • Game progression

Good level design keeps players engaged and encourages them to continue playing.

AR and VR in Game Design

One of the fastest-growing areas in gaming is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R).

AR Gaming

AR overlays digital content onto the real world through smartphones or AR devices.

Examples:

  • Pokémon GO
  • Interactive learning games
  • Location-based experiences

VR Gaming

VR creates fully immersive gaming environments using headsets.

Examples:

  • Simulation games
  • Adventure games
  • Training applications
  • Virtual experiences

Students learning game design in 2026 should understand AR and VR concepts because these technologies are creating new career opportunities globally.

Building a Career: The Importance of a Strong Portfolio

In 3D animation, no resume element carries more weight than a showreel. A showreel is a short compilation — typically 60 to 90 seconds — of an artist’s best work. It is the primary instrument through which studios evaluate candidates, and it matters far more than academic credentials.

This means that from the very beginning of their learning journey, animation students should be thinking about what work they are creating, how it demonstrates their skills, and how it is presented online. Strong portfolio work from personal projects, student productions, and internship assignments consistently results in employment for skilled graduates, regardless of which city they are based in.

3D animation refers broadly to the creation of animated content in a three-dimensional digital environment. VFX (Visual Effects) specifically refers to the integration of digitally created imagery with live-action footage. VFX relies heavily on 3D animation skills, but also incorporates compositing, color science, and film production knowledge.
